ABOUT CIC CIC is a global leader in building & operating innovation communities. Founded in 1999 in Cambridge, MA, CIC is one of the first companies to offer flexible office space & coworking options, providing a platform for the world's most impactful entrepreneurs to innovate better & faster.
We have locations in Boston, Cambridge, Miami, Philadelphia, Providence, Rotterdam, St. Louis, Warsaw, & Tokyo & are growing into other cities, within the US & abroad. CIC has supported over 6,000 startups, growth companies, & branches of larger organizations, representing for-profit, mission-driven, & non-profit sectors across a wide array of industries.
CIC co-founded a number of mission-aligned organizations including Venture Caf, CIC's primary non-profit programming partner, & CIC Health, offering COVID-19 testing services to companies & the public.
